Richard Leman

We are sorry to share the news that our friend and former colleague, Richard Leman, passed away on Friday 13 January 2023.

Our thoughts are with Richard’s family and friends at this very sad time.

Richard joined Actons in the 1960s and after qualifying as a Solicitor was promoted to Partner in the same year, specialising in Insolvency and Commercial Litigation.  Richard was a leading figure in the insolvency market during his career and was one of the country’s first Licensed Insolvency Practitioners.  He nurtured and mentored many colleagues during his career.

Richard became our Senior Partner in 1980 – a role he held for 27 years until 2007.  During his period of leadership he was instrumental in over-seeing the development and expansion of the firm in both size and stature.  Richard helped set up a homeless charity which in due course was one of the two charities that merged to form what is now called Framework. He also acted as a trustee and supported other charities across Nottingham and Nottinghamshire.

Richard retired as a director of the firm in April 2009 although was a Consultant to Actons in the years that followed. He remained a dear friend to many across the firm and was a regular visitor to the office.

Richard was described by clients, colleagues and industry peers alike as dynamic and charismatic.  He was very sociable and will be missed by former clients and colleagues.
